6 dogs in ‘horrible conditions’ dumped at Pa. animal shelter Updated May 11, 2021; Six dogs were dumped in “horrible conditions” at a Whitehall no-kill shelter, the Lehigh County Humane Society said. The dogs were left at Peaceable Kingdom along MacArthur Road, Barbara Morgan, the Lehigh County Humane Society’s police officer, told lehighvalleylive.com Sunday. The humane society took to Facebook Saturday evening asking for the public’s help in finding a pair believed responsible. Morgan shared photos of the individuals and asked anyone who recognized them to contact authorities. She also shared photos of dogs with their fur severely matted and and covered in feces.
